What temperature should I cook chicken to?

Cooking chicken at the correct temperature is important in order to ensure that it is cooked through and safe to eat. The temperature at which chicken is cooked will vary depending on the method used, but in general, chicken should be cooked to an internal temperature of 165 degrees Fahrenheit.

There are a few different ways to cook chicken, and each has its own recommended cooking temperature. For example, when cooking chicken in the oven, it should be cooked to an internal temperature of 165 degrees Fahrenheit. When cooking chicken on the grill, it should be cooked to an internal temperature of 165 degrees Fahrenheit or higher, as the heat of the grill will not be high enough to cook chicken all the way through.

It is important to note that the temperature at which chicken is cooked is not the only factor that determines whether or not it is cooked through. The size of the chicken pieces will also affect the cooking time, so it is important to test the chicken for doneness before removing it from the heat. A good way to do this is to use a meat thermometer to check the internal temperature of the chicken.

If you are not sure whether or not your chicken is cooked through, it is always better to cook it for a little longer than to risk getting sick from undercooked chicken. By cooking chicken to an internal temperature of 165 degrees Fahrenheit, you can be sure that it is cooked through and safe to eat.

How long does chicken cook at 400?

How long does chicken cook at 400 degrees? The recommended cooking time for a whole chicken at 400 degrees Fahrenheit is approximately 75 minutes. However, it is important to note that the cook time may vary depending on the size and weight of the chicken.

When cooking chicken at 400 degrees, it is important to ensure that the chicken is fully cooked through. A simple way to check for doneness is to use a meat thermometer. The chicken should reach an internal temperature of 165 degrees Fahrenheit.

If you are looking for a crispy skin on your chicken, it is recommended that you roast the chicken at a higher temperature of 425 degrees Fahrenheit. The cook time will be reduced to about 45 minutes.

One of the benefits of cooking chicken at 400 degrees is that it produces moist and juicy meat. The high temperature sears the chicken skin, which helps to keep the meat moist.

If you are looking for a quick and easy way to cook chicken, using the oven at 400 degrees is a great option. Just make sure to keep an eye on the chicken so that it does not overcook.
